While adding a 240 litre water butt to your cart, you have an option to buy a Downpipe Diverter which provides an entry point for the water from your downpipe to the water butt. The key difference between the Harcostar Diverter & the Gutter Mate Diverter & Filter is that the Harcostar will only divert the water, whereas the Gutter Mate will divert AND filter the water, stopping any unwanted leaves and moss entering the rain barrel and therefore helping to stop clogging and contamination of the water. We would suggest that if you have a soak away or large water butt, the Gutter Mate might be the better option as this will stop unwanted leaves and moss clogging up your soak away and will save you from having to clean your water butt. Once the water butt is full, the diverters will redirect the excess water back down the drainpipe.
Another option you have is to add a ¾” blanking plug to your water butt. This is only necessary if you are purchasing the 240 litre or 350 litre barrel and are either (i) going to use the upper hole for your tap and therefore need to fill in the bottom hole with a plug, or (ii) you find it more aesthetically pleasing to have the upper hole with a plug in place. Please note: On the 240 litre & 350 litre water butts, the lower hole has been opened to allow water through and the upper hole remains closed and secure for holding water unless you decide to open it.

Why should I collect rainwater?
- Collecting free rainwater allows you to reduce your water bill and provides water which is free from chlorine - a chemical added to drinking water that inhibits plant growth. Another benefit of storing rainwater outside is the natural temperature of the water, which will not shock your plants like cold water from a tap can do.
Connecting Rain Barrels and Water Butts together:
- If you decide that you want to connect your rain barrels together at the start or in the future, this is not a problem. All you need to do is run a connecting pipe between both barrels which allows the water to pass between them both. You only need to have one filter for both barrels or water butts as this is connected to your guttering downpipe.
